Dryden's Fable of the Hind and the Panther, Considered With Regard to the Ecclesiastical Policy of James the Second

This book analyzes the political and religious allegory in John Dryden's famous poem, exploring its relevance to the ecclesiastical policies of James II. Bernard Vildhaut provides a comprehensive examination of the poem's themes and the historical context in which it was written.
